Overall Meaning

The song "On My Way To You" by Aaron Pritchett is a reflective piece about the journey the singer took to find true love. The lyrics paint a picture of past relationships that ultimately led him to the one he loves. The song is about heartbreak, perseverance, and finding love when you least expect it.


The first verse speaks of a girl in Albuquerque who hurt the singer, possibly through a failed relationship. The pain of that experience leads him to move in with someone he knew from college. However, that relationship also fizzles out. The line "A lot of little things fell through" implies that the singer tried to find love in various ways, but things didn't work out until he met the person he is currently with. He regrets the time he lost spinning his wheels trying to find love.


The chorus speaks to the emotional journey he went through before finding his current love. He "hurt, walked, ran, and crawled" trying to find the truth of what real love is. However, he ultimately found it with the person he sings to in the song. She was a "brick wall in a road" that he didn't think would end, but her open arms ultimately led him to her heart.
